Product Overview

The LT4363IMS-1#PBF belongs to the category of voltage surge protectors. It is designed to provide protection for sensitive electronic equipment against overvoltage transients. The device offers characteristics such as high efficiency, compact package, and robust surge protection capabilities. It is available in a small MSOP-10 package and is an essential component for safeguarding electronic systems from damaging voltage surges.

Working Principles

The LT4363IMS-1#PBF operates by monitoring the input voltage and providing protection when it exceeds the preset threshold. It utilizes a combination of voltage clamping and current limiting to safeguard downstream electronics from damaging voltage surges. The device also incorporates undervoltage lockout and reverse voltage protection to ensure comprehensive protection for connected systems.
